For starters, let’s cover what breast augmentation is. Breast augmentation is a surgical procedure designed to enhance the size, fullness and volume of breasts. The procedure,clinically known as augmentation mammaplasty, involves surgical placement of saline or silicone gel based breast implants in the breast tissue.

 Breast augmentation may be recommended in the following situations:

  • The patient is dissatisfied with the naturally small size of her breasts and is keen to improve the size and volume.
  • The patient is keen to enhance the size for cosmetic reasons, even when the breasts are of average size.
  • The patient suffers from asymmetrical breasts, which can be made proportionate with breast implants.
  • The patient has experienced loss of breast volume following a pregnancy or major weight loss.
  • The patient has suffered breast tissue damage due to an injury or has undergone a mastectomy, and needs breast reconstruction.

Factors Affecting the Cost of Breast Augmentation

Breast augmentation cosmetic surgery cost may differ from one practice to another in different locations or even within the same location. A number of factors may influence the overall cost of the procedure.

Geographical Location of the Practice

The cost of breast augmentation at a practice located in Plano, Frisco, Dallas or nearby areas may differ from the cost of the same procedure in Los Angeles or San Francisco. This can happen because the cost of living index may vary between two cities or two states, and the costs of all kinds of goods and services, including surgical procedures may be impacted by this index.

Surgeon’s Fee

The fee charged by the plastic surgeon is an important component of the overall cost of breast augmentation. The skills, experience, and reputation of a surgeon for a particular procedure may determine the fee charged by him or her. Some surgeons are in high demand for a procedure and may charge a higher fee because they are hard-pressed for time.

Operating Facility and Anesthesia Costs

If the breast augmentation procedure is performed at a state of the art surgical facility equipped with the latest technologies and resources, back-up of an experienced support staff, and providing high quality comforts and services, the costs of the facility may be higher than an average facility. In a procedure such as breast augmentation, the costs of general anesthesia should also be considered because the procedure is usually performed under general anesthesia.

Length and Complexity of Surgery

The extent of the surgery involved may vary from case to case, and this may have an impact on the overall costs of the procedure. In some cases, breast augmentation procedure may be combined with a breast lift. The cost will go up proportionately in such situations.

Cost of Implants

While making an estimate of costs of breast augmentation, it is important to assess the cost of breast implants. Saline implants may cost a little cheaper compared to silicone gel implants. The latest highly cohesive silicone implant qualities may be more expensive. The choice of implant type, size, and shape may have an impact on the overall cost of procedure.

Other Related Expenses

The patient should also take into account other related costs such as the cost of any pre- or post-op medical tests, mammogram, prescription medications, and surgical garments. With an accurate estimate of total costs, the patient is in a better position to make an informed decision about the cosmetic surgery procedure and make arrangements for the payment accordingly.

Average Cost of Breast Augmentation

According to the American Society of Plastic Surgeons (ASPS), the national average cost of breast augmentation surgery in 2012 was $3,543. However, this is a just a basic cost figure, which does not include costs of operating room and anesthesia. The ASPS says that the actual cost of the procedure may vary from one practice to another due to several factors.

The choice of breast implants and other aspects will also impact the cost significantly. If the procedure is performed purely for cosmetic reasons, it may not be covered under the patient’s health insurance plan. In such case, the patients have an option of getting the procedure financed through professional medical care finance firms.
